In line with our strategy of introducing new services and evolving existing solutions, BICS is seeking a Telecom & DevOps Engineer to help design, develop, deploy, and support advanced telecommunications solutions for 4G/5G networks, with a focus on roaming, messaging, and Internet of Things (IoT) services.
In this role, you will contribute across the full solution life cycle (design, build, test, deployment, support, and maintenance). Working in an agile environment, you will ensure high-quality technical delivery and support successful execution of business projects and evolutive initiatives (time, budget, scope).
Please note: this role requires working from the Madrid office 2 to 3 days per week. It is not a fully remote position. ENG Fluency is a must.
